Transaction 21aacc07dab0ec6e98266028b095d748e1b94720ef48adba5c9e681dfcb3d59a
1 Input
1 Output
-
21aacc07dab0ec6e98266028b095d748e1b94720ef48adba5c9e681dfcb3d59a:0
- value
- 43371
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ce3cfb3e843ea887dba97950e5debbd1dd16334
- address
- bc1qpn3ulvlgg04gsld6j72suh0th5wazce5gzy5xm